Meet Marites! Marites has been able to shine her talents at a busy hairdressing salon with support from our Inclusive Employment Australia (IEA) program.
Originally from the Philippines, Marites is a friendly, chatty person who used to work in customs administration. But she had always dreamed of being a hairdresser.
A mixture of things, including being a carer for elderly parents, parenting teenagers and living with schizophrenia, had made it challenging for Marites to find the right kind of work.
When Marites contacted us, she hadn’t worked for 10 years. She was ready to dive into a new work adventure!
Marites chatted to us about her hairdressing dream and about wanting to find meaningful work that she could manage alongside her disability and busy schedule.
How IEA supported Marites to find her dream job
After Marites called her local IEA office to register, we set about making Marites dream a reality.
With her personal employment consultant, at her side, Marites was able to identify her skills and strengths. Together they found fun ways to build her confidence and prepare her resume.
“In Afford they look job for me…and I don’t have to worry about job search,” says Marites.
“They treat me like family.”
Marites’ employment consultant contacted a local hairdressing business to see if they were interested in employing a person with disability. They helped them understand the benefits Marites could bring to their workplace, and they were keen to give it a go.
The next step was to organise a job interview, and to practice Marites’ interview skills together before the real thing.
This helped Marites feel prepared and present herself at her very best. And it worked, because she got the job!
Marites’ professional highlights
Marites has been loving her job at the hairdressing salon ever since. Her boss has taught her new skills, and Marites feels more confident every day.
“I’m happy working at a hairdressing salon” says Marites. “It help your self-confidence to grow, you can use your time, your effort and your ability.”
“Afford supports me to feel good about going to work. I feel happy, I feel good about myself.”
Marites’ personal IEA consultant, has been with her every step of the way. She checks in with Marites and her employer regularly to make sure they are going okay and to see if there’s anything we can do to make things even better.

IEA used to be called Disability Employment Services (DES). DES changed to IEA on 1 November 2025.
